I really enjoyed this autobiography of Essie Mae Washington-Williams. She lived through many disappointments but came out a winner in life. The rejection she feels by her father's lack of public acknowlegement of her existence comes through loud and clear. She is generous in her praise for him in the one area where he never let her down - in his financial support. In spite of the many challenges in her life, Essie Mae was a successful woman in her own right - which her father was proud of.
